Team UP - Supportive Program Specialist
 
 
 
Led by the United Way of Southwest Colorado, Team UP AmeriCorps places AmeriCorps members at organizations throughout Southwest Colorado. Through collaborative service, Team UP AmeriCorps members develop their own professional skills and passions, expand effectiveness of southwest Colorado organizations, and ultimately support people to thrive. Each Team UP AmeriCorps member serves directly at a non-profit, school, or government agency called their Host Site. Members serving at different Host Sites are all part of the Team UP AmeriCorps member cohort; the cohort meets periodically to connect, learn, and build community together. Members are placed at Host Sites based on their specific skills and interests, as well as their desired location of service. We have both Full- and Part-time positions in a variety of focus areas. All positions require a motivated individual that is committed to improving the well-being of community members in beautiful southwest Colorado. Position focus areas include, but are not limited to: youth development, restorative justice, immigrant resource navigation, economic mobility, housing security, social emotional learning, and early childhood education. Member Duties : This Team UP AC member will serve as the Supportive Program Specialist at the Espero Apartments/HSSW in Durango, Colorado. The Supportive Programming Specialist will expand supportive services for tenants at Espero apartments and Emergency Housing Voucher program participants through the Statewide Supportive Housing Expansion Pilot Project (SWSHE). The member will provide direct services to Espero residents and people exiting homelessness and transitioning into housing. The member will identify tenancy-sustaining services for individuals with complex needs and work with program staff to find new and creative ways to deliver needed services.
